James Tam The history of computers and computing: Part I A short talk on some early computing devices and the people behind those inventions.

Slides:



Advertisements
Similar presentations
Computer Skills Preparatory Year Presented by: L. Obead Alhadreti.
Advertisements

4/23/2015Engineering Problem Solving with C++ second edition, J. ingber 1 Engineering Problem Solving with C++, Etter/Ingber Chapter 1.
Introduction to Computers 2010 Class: ________________ Name: ________________.
History of Computers.
There are three ages of computer Dark age Middle age Modern age
DPW Network Security 101 Session 1. DPW Early Mechanical Computers AbacusPascaline machine Napier’s Bones Stepped Reckoner Arithmometer Punch cards Babbage’s.
Lecture 1 “History and Evolution of Computers” Informatics.
History of Computers. Definition of Computer One who computes A device for making calculations A programmable electronic device that stores, retrieves,
History of the computer
Computer Architecture CPSC 321 Andreas Klappenecker.
James Tam Non decimal math: doing math with non-base 10 number systems Addition, subtraction and multiplication with binary, octal and hexadecimal.
James Tam The history of computers and computing: Part II The computers of the 20 th century and the people behind those machines.
CS 104 Introduction to Computer Science and Graphics Problems History of Computer 09/05/2008 Yang Song (Prepared by Yang Song and Suresh Solaimuthu)
James Tam The history of computers and computing: Part I A short talk on some early computing devices and the people behind those inventions.
A Brief History of Computers
Some of these slides are based on material from the ACM Computing Curricula 2005.
KEYBOARD – an input device used to type data.
Evolution of Computers
Computer history timeline
COMPUTING DEVICE I (PRE COMPUTER AGE TO 19TH CENTURY)
Four Basic Period of Computer History
William OughtredWilliam Oughtred and others developed the slide rule in the 17th century based on the emerging work on logarithms by John Napier. Before.
Evolution of computing devices
© Prentice-Hall, Inc Definition  Computer - An electronic device that has the ability to store, retrieve, and process data and can be programmed with.
CSCI Milestones in Computer Development Fall 2007.
History of Digital Computers
The History of Computers. People have almost always looked for tools to aid in calculation. The human hand was probably the first tool used to help people.
Machines that Think? Presented by Lucas Mellinger.
EVOLUTION OF COMPUTERS
Machines that Think? Electronic Computers Sketch 23 Presented By: Peter Haagenson.
1 COMS 161 Introduction to Computing Title: Computer Organization Date: March 25, 2005 Lecture Number: 27.
The U.S. Military and the History of Computing War! What is it good for? Absolutely Nothing! -Edwin Starr.
© Prentice-Hall, Inc Definition  Computer - An electronic device that has the ability to store, retrieve, and process data and can be programmed with.
1.1 The Computer Revolution. Computer Revolution Early calculating machines Mechanical devices used to add and subtract By Babylonian (Iraq) 5000 years.
1 History of Computers (Excerpts from CMPE3). 2 The History of Computers The history of computers is interesting (or should be if you are in this class)
From the abacus to microprocessors Exploring the Digital Domain The History of Digital Computers.
The Mechanical Age
1 History of Computers Source – IEEE 50 th anniversary of modern computing timeline Up to 50 years.
History of Computers.
CSCI 161 Class 1 Martin van Bommel.
COMP 268 Computer Organization and Assembly Language A Brief History of Computing Architecture.
History of Computers.
Lesson 2: History of Computers
The History of Computers What is a computer? A computer is an electronic machine that accepts information (Data), processes it according.
History of Computing. Where did it start? Abucus 500 B.C. The abacus was first used by the Babylonians as an aid to simple arithmetic at sometime around.
The History Of Computers: Part I
The History of the Computer and the Internet By: Kelsie Liebel.
2 WELCOME TO HISTORYPRESENTATION OF COMPUTER WELCOME TO HISTORYPRESENTATION OF COMPUTER.
Integrantes: Leonardo Camus Jocelin Olivares Claudia Hernández Curso: 4medio C Fecha: 19/08/10.
Counting with pebbles in the Stone-age. The first known calculator, Abacus, was invented in Babylonia in 2400 BC.
Computer History How did we get here?.
LECTURE#2 INTRODUCTION TO COMPUTERS, HISTORY AND APPLICATIONS INSTRUCTOR: M. MATEEN YAQOOB.
History of The Computer and The Internet Jessie :D.
Why build a computer? u Computers were developed to mechanize mathematical computations. u Two definitions:  A computer is “a programmable electronic.
Answer the following questions in one or two sentences each:
History of Computers. Do you know who this really happy looking guy is???? Charles Babbage- also known as the Father of Computers.
Information Age “An in depth look at the exciting history of the Calculator and Computer”
History of Information Technology and System Four basic periods Characterized by a principal technology used to solve the input, processing, output and.
You may need to know this for a test????. What is a computer "Computer" was originally a job title: it was used to describe those human beings (predominantly.
Introduction to Information Technology, D3 FMIPA UGM Chapter 1 Brief History of Computer Technology 1.
Early Mechanical Computing Machines G. Donald Allen Department of Mathematics Texas A&M University.
History of computer science
Chapter 0: Introduction
Introduction to Computers
History And Development Of Computer
What was the first computer?
Milestones in Computer Development
COMS 161 Introduction to Computing
INTRODUCTION Term “Computer” Computer definition Data Information
Presentation transcript:

James Tam The history of computers and computing: Part I A short talk on some early computing devices and the people behind those inventions

James Tam The abacus Not just a child’s toy! A skilled abacus operator can be faster than the operator of a mechanical calculating machines. Origins forgotten over time

James Tam Abacuses from different parts of the world Chinese Seun Poon Japanese Soroban Greek (from the Darius vase) Pictures from the History of Computing Technology by Michael R. Williams

James Tam Gunter’s quadrant Devised by Dr. Edmund Gunter in the 16 th century Used calculation, navigation and sun dialling.

James Tam The Sector Developed in the 17 th century Used by artillerists to operate and fire cannons

James Tam Napier’s Bones Used to perform various mathematical functions (multiplication, square and cube roots) Also known as numbering rods, multiplying rulers, speaking rods Picture from the History of Computing Technology by Michael R. Williams

James Tam Pascal’s and his calculating machines A “self –made” philosopher and mathematician Developed almost 50 different calculating machines

James Tam Internal mechanisms of Pascal’s machine Picture from the History of Computing Technology by Michael R. Williams

James Tam Leibniz’s multiply machine He expanded the original concepts in Pascal’s calculating machine (multiplication) Leibniz’s machine Internal workings

James Tam Charles Babbage Often referred to as the grandfather of the computer age Another wild “self taught” mathematician Absolutely brilliant! Member of many academic organizations e.g. Member of the Extractors (Rules) 1) Every member must communicate his address to the Secretary at least once every six months. 2) If this communication was delayed beyond 12 months, it would be taken for granted that his relatives had shut him up as insane. 3)Every effort legal and illegal shall be made to get him out of the madhouse (hence the term “extractors”. 4) Every candidate for admission shall produce six certificates to be kept on file – three that he is sane and three that he is not. Quotes from the History of Computing Technology by Michael R. Williams

James Tam History of Babbage’s Difference Engine Designed to complete many mathematical functions Cost ~ $184,000 (1842 currency rates) But it was never finished

James Tam Woodcut of Babbage’s Difference Engine Picture from the History of Computing Technology by Michael R. Williams

James Tam Modern construction of the Difference Engine The ‘simplified version’ was huge and complicated: 10’ high x 6’ long with 4000 parts and weighing in at 3 tons

James Tam The Bell Complex Number Calculator

James Tam The Harvard Mark I

James Tam John Atanasoff, Clifford Berry, and the ABC

James Tam The ENIAC

James Tam The Enigma

James Tam The first SPC

James Tam Early Super Computers: The Stretch

James Tam Summary (important points) How do perform basic mathematical operations (addition, subtraction and multiplication in different bases) Binary Octal Hexadecimal